A green, quiet apartment in 's-Gravenland

This apartment on Jacques Dutilhweg sits in a leafy, peaceful part of Rotterdam. With 91 m² and energy label B, it's a comfortable home that feels spacious without being oversized. The asking price of €330,000 is well below the neighbourhood average of €992,276, partly because the home is smaller than the typical 's-Gravenland property. For context, apartments in Rotterdam vary widely in price and size.

The neighbourhood: 's-Gravenland

Residents describe 's-Gravenland as "very beautiful, green and quiet" with "nice people" and "all amenities within short distance." One long-term resident says: "I love living here, feel safe, shops nearby, nature close by, what more could one want.. great apartment, nicely finished, view. I'll grow old here." Another notes it's "easily accessible by car or electric bike" but that "with a normal bike everything is just a bit too far." The neighbourhood 's-Gravenland is home to many families and older residents, with a mix of houses and apartments.

Life on the street

For daily shopping, the Albert Heijn is just around the corner. A couple of streets away you'll find Pluspunt primary school, and within a ten-minute walk there are several other schools like KC De Stelberg and De Vijfster. I lived on Ringvaartweg. I found it a bit unsociable. I did have neighbours I could talk to across the street and a bit further down. The rest I hardly saw or spoke to. If I drove up in a new car, the whole neighbourhood was alert. You might find that nice for safety. I found it felt a bit strange. A couple of nice little lakes nearby, enjoyed skating there in winter. At the end of Ringvaartweg there's a station, so it's fairly easy to reach. I think the neighbourhoods around Ringvaartweg would have been nicer, although I didn't live there but of course often cycled and walked through them.

Is €330,000 a fair price for this apartment?

The asking price of €330,000 is 67% below the average asking price in 's-Gravenland (€992,276), but this apartment is also 44% smaller than the neighbourhood average of 162 m². Given the size and energy label B, the price is in line with the market for a 91 m² apartment in this area.

What is the energy label and what does it mean?

The energy label is B, which means the home is reasonably energy-efficient. You can expect moderate energy bills compared to older homes with lower labels. In 's-Gravenland, 42.5% of homes have label A and 22.5% have label B, so this apartment is in line with the local standard.
